Hi. Here's a tank I made during the weekend, it has radio controll so beware LEGO purists ,) (URL) used a five channel radio, five servos, five polarity switches and five motors to make this work. It has two motors for drive, left and right track, (...) (25 years ago, 2-Nov-00, to lugnet.technic, lugnet.robotics) !

You can use NQC language in Scout, you can use touch and light sensor in Scout, I think it is better than RCX and similar with RCX2, except it only 2 input and output port and can't use rotation and temperature sensor. Zhengrong (...) (25 years ago, 2-Nov-00, to lugnet.robotics)
